少儿编程老师要什么技术
-
少儿编程老师需要掌握一定的技术和能力,以便能够教授和引导学生进行编程学习。以下是少儿编程老师所需要的技术要求:
-
编程语言:作为一名编程老师,至少需要精通一种编程语言,比如Python、Scratch、JavaScript等。熟练掌握编程语言的语法和基本控制结构,能够写出简单的程序,并能解释其原理和功能。
-
理解计算机基础知识:了解计算机的基本原理和工作方式,熟悉计算机的硬件和操作系统,能够对学生解释计算机是如何工作的,并引导他们理解计算机科学的基本概念。
-
熟悉编程工具和环境:掌握常见的编程工具和集成开发环境(IDE),例如Visual Studio Code、PyCharm等。能够指导学生使用这些工具进行编程,包括编辑代码、调试程序、运行测试等。
-
项目开发经验:具备一定的项目开发经验,并能够指导学生完成编程项目。能够帮助学生制定项目计划,组织编程团队,合理分配任务,并跟踪项目进展。
-
教学和沟通能力:作为一名编程老师,需要具备良好的教学和沟通能力。能够将复杂的编程概念和知识讲解清晰易懂,能够与学生进行有效的互动和交流,激发学生的兴趣和学习动力。
-
学习能力和持续学习:编程领域发展迅速,新的编程语言和技术不断涌现。作为少儿编程老师,需要保持学习的态度和习惯,不断更新自己的知识和技能,与时俱进。
综上所述,少儿编程老师需要掌握编程语言、理解计算机基础知识、熟悉编程工具和环境,具备项目开发经验,以及良好的教学和沟通能力。此外,持续学习和更新自己的知识也是十分重要的。
1年前 -
-
作为一名少儿编程老师,你需要掌握以下技术:
-
编程语言:作为少儿编程老师,你应该精通至少一种编程语言,如Scratch、Python、JavaScript等。这些语言都有广泛的应用范围,并且易于学习和理解。你需要能够熟练运用这些语言来教授学生编程基础知识和技巧。
-
教学工具:为了有效地教授少儿编程,你需要熟练掌握一些教学工具和软件,如Scratch、Code.org、Tynker等。这些工具可以帮助学生更好地理解编程概念和实践编程技术。此外,你还需要了解课堂管理工具,如ClassDojo或Google Classroom,以便更好地组织和管理你的课程。
-
创意思维:少儿编程培养学生的创造力和解决问题的能力。作为一名老师,你需要培养学生的创意思维,帮助他们产生创新的编程想法和解决方案。因此,你需要具备良好的创意思维能力,能够引导学生进行创意编程项目和挑战。
-
课程设计:作为少儿编程老师,你需要具备良好的课程设计能力。你需要根据不同年龄段学生的需求和能力,设计出合适的教学内容和活动。你需要了解学生的学习进度和兴趣,以便能够调整和改进你的教学计划。
-
沟通和协作能力:作为一名教师,你需要与学生、家长和其他教育机构保持良好的沟通和合作关系。你需要能够清晰地向学生解释编程概念,并且能够与家长交流学生的学习进展。此外,你还需要与其他教师和教育专家进行合作,以提高教学质量和效果。
总之,作为一名少儿编程老师,你需要具备良好的编程技术、教学工具和创意思维能力。同时,你还需要具备良好的课程设计、沟通和协作能力,以便能够成功教授少儿编程并与学生、家长和其他教育机构保持良好的合作关系。
1年前 -
-
作为一名少儿编程老师,具备以下技术能力是非常重要的:
-
编程语言掌握能力:作为一名编程老师,必须熟练掌握至少一到两种编程语言,常用的编程语言包括Scratch、Python、Java、C++等。熟练掌握这些编程语言的语法和特性,能在教学过程中进行代码编写、调试和演示。
-
控制硬件的能力:编程不仅仅是写代码,还涉及到控制硬件的能力。作为少儿编程老师,应该具备一定的硬件知识,例如Arduino、树莓派等,能够使用编程语言编写控制硬件的程序。
-
项目开发的能力:在教授编程的过程中,通过项目开发可以帮助学生更好地理解编程概念和应用。作为一名少儿编程老师,应该具备项目开发的能力,能够指导学生完成一些小型的编程项目,例如制作一个小游戏、设计一个机器人等。
-
网络编程的能力:随着互联网的发展,网络编程变得越来越重要。作为一名编程老师,应该具备一定的网络编程能力,能够教授学生如何使用编程语言进行网络应用的开发,例如制作一个简单的网页、开发一个网络聊天程序等。
-
教学能力:除了编程技术能力之外,作为一名少儿编程老师,还需要具备良好的教学能力。要能够根据学生的不同需求和水平,选择合适的教学方法和教材,能够激发学生的学习兴趣,帮助他们理解和掌握编程知识。
-
沟通能力和团队合作能力:作为一名编程老师,需要与学生和家长进行良好的沟通,解答他们的疑问,了解他们的学习需求。此外,在一些编程教育机构中,需要与其他老师和团队成员合作,共同开展教学活动,因此具备良好的团队合作能力也是非常重要的。
总之,作为一名少儿编程老师,除了良好的编程技术能力,还需要具备教学能力、沟通能力和团队合作能力,才能够更好地教授学生编程知识。
1年前 -